A team of volunteers has recently completed a research project on the history of the Guildford Union Workhouse Infirmary, which became St. Luke's Hospital. An exhibition has been created for display in the Education Room of the former hospital building. Once part of the complex, the Spike is available for tours.

The site of the medieval manor and Tudor Palace of Woking will be open for the first time this year on 11th & 12th May. Guided tours of the 8 acre moated site and its above ground remains will run throughout the day until 4pm.
